  1. Wynwood Walls Art Tour

The Wynwood Walls is as an outdoor art museum founded in 2009, which revived approximately 80,000 square feet of abandoned warehouse walls. The community turned the run-down neighborhood into a new spot for art-lovers. Wynwood Walls is free and open to the public, located between 25th and 26th street at 2520 NW Second Avenue.

  1. Little Havana Culture Tour

Come see the authentic Cuban culture and the history behind, the decorative “Calle 8” or 8th Street, one of Miami’s oldest towns.
